Farm to School Census Highlights Farmer Benefits of Program

USDA’s first-ever Farm to School Census showed that in the 2011-12 school year more than 38-thousand schools participating in program purchased and served more than 350-million dollars in local food to their 21-million students. Florida Bills Would Give Tax Help to Farmers

From The News Service of Florida: Looking to help farmers, Sen. Wilton Simpson, R-Trilby, and Rep. Jake Raburn, R-Lithia, filed bills this week that would create new tax exemptions for the agriculture industry.
